Located in Mathews County, Virginia, Mathews is a community with a population of 1,145. Its median household income of $53,108 runs below the Mathews County figure of $75,487.
Between 2019 and 2023, Mathews's population grew 101.2% from 569 to 1,145, while its median home value rose 4.1% from $171,500 to $178,600.
The largest age group is 5 to 17, 17.5% of residents. White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 94.9% of the population.
